A chimney sweep will certainly do a thorough chimney cleaning to get rid of any kind of deposits, residue, creosote, as well as obstructions from the chimney. Filthy, damaged deteriorating, and blocked chimneys cause injuries and also fires every year. If you use you fire place or wood burning stove, the National Fire Protection Association suggests having your chimney inspected and also swept every year in order to protect against fires.

What does a chimney sweep do?

A chimney service specialist will do a complete cleaning of your chimney. Cleaning logs are really ineffective and also are not recommended. They will not remove all the soot and creosote build-up out of the chimney like hand cleaning.

Step 1: Protecting

To start, a cleaning service technician will shield the inside of your house by spreading out tarps over the room, flooring, and also hearth. They will cover the fire place with plastic sheets, putting an industrial vacuum hose pipe into the fire place, and will then tape and also seal the fireplace. They'll attach extension hose pipes and run them to the industrial vacuum with a fine micron filter which rests outdoors. This will trap the fine residue, creosote, and other dust later.

Step 2: Sweeping

Next, they will brush the entire chimney with hand held brushes, and also brushes with extension poles. Typically they will begin on top of the chimney and work downward, thoroughly brushing all the surface areas. Your chimney sweep will clean the flue, the damper, the smoke chamber, the smoke shelf, and the firebox.

Step 3: Tidy up

They will after that peel back a small area of the vinyl sheeting and use a range of brushes inside. Following this, everything will be vacuumed as well as cleaned up. The vinyl sheeting and tarps will be moved outside, cleaned and tucked back into their vehicle.

What exactly is creosote?

Creosote is a brown, oily, tar-like substance which develops from burning wood or coal. It starts as a loose, downy build up which at first can be brushed away easily. As it accumulates much more, it becomes tar-like, and is harder to eliminate, in some cases requiring the use of scrapers to remove it. If left uncleaned, and more layers develop, the creosote hardens.

When a fire is burned in the fireplace or wood stove, the smoke becomes extremely hot. Hardened creosote can start to drip and also melt like wax. When the build up of creosote is extremely hefty, it restricts the air flow through the chimney flue. The restricted air circulation causes creosote to build up even faster.

Is creosote unsafe?

Creosote is harmful in a number of different ways. It's toxic and harmful for your health, and it places your home at risk of fires.

Carbon monoxide gas

Creosote build up triggers diminished air movement and this can enable carbon monoxide gas to accumulate inside your house while a fire is burning. Carbon monoxide is an odorless and colorless gas which can cause flu-like symptoms, and can even lead to death.

Creosote Toxicity

Besides the carbon monoxide accumulation, creosote itself is poisonous. It can trigger inflamed skin and eyes, breathing issues, and is carcinogenic (cancer triggering).

Fire Hazard

The most dangerous feature of creosote is that it is exceptionally flammable. It's the most common cause of chimney fires. While chimneys are made to hold up against a high degree of heat, the intensity of a chimney fire can promptly exceed this degree.

Exactly how often should my chimney be cleaned?

How frequently a chimney should be cleaned depends of exactly how often you use it and also what materials you burn within. Gas burning fire places need to be inspected every year. Although they burn cleaner, moisture, debris, cracks and various other issues can develop which can permit carbon monoxide gas to enter into the home.

Oil burning flues should be cleaned once a year to prevent soot from building up.

Due to the fact that wood burning fireplaces and stoves produce more residue and creosote, they should be swept a lot more often. A great rule of thumb is to have your chimney swept after a cord of wood has been burned within.
